    07 Tohatsu 3.5 4stroke...overheating?

    If it was a freshwater engine, the thermostat is good and the water pump is in good condition, then odds are you're fine. Four strokes run hotter than 2 strokes so if your reference was an old 2 stroke then that's not a good comparison.

    What's wrong with my new 6hp Tohatsu?

    Yes the instructions give you both pressures, with and without the compression release. You should be looking for right about 49psi with the compression release active.
